Dust mites, mold, bacteria, and germs; every home and building has them floating around in the air. They are optimized to float until they land in an area that they can reproduce in. When inhaled, these particles can cause you to become sick, which forces you to spend hard-earned money a trip to the doctor and for medicine.
These contaminants can also cause you to have dangerous allergic reactions that can send you to the hospital. These reactions can occasionally be lethal.
Our homes trap these microscopic organisms in with us. Our houses are built to be air-tight, to keep our heating and cooling costs down during the winter and summer months. However, because our homes are sealed shut, these germs become trapped in the house, and are free to reproduce if they float to the right conditions, or if we breathe them in. The EPA recently ranked indoor air pollution in the top five of environmental concerns effecting public health. Small, lightweight mold spores and bacteria float freely in the air for children, adults and pets to inhale.
Asthma is one of the most common respiratory disorders in the world. About 34.1 million Americans have been diagnosed with asthma. 300 million people world wide suffer from asthma. In the United States in 2005, 3,384 deaths could be attributed to asthma attacks. Asthma can be triggered by mold spores and dust mites which are common in a home’s circulating air.

Our UV light goes inside your duct, after your filter, to purify the air as it goes through the system. As the particles pass in front of the UV bulb, the germs, mold and bacteria receive a dose of Ultraviolet Light. The UV light destroys the DNA of the bacteria and kills it on a molecular level.
